Spring 2001 Newsletter

 

Township Begins Emphasis On Economic Development Through Business Expansion And Retention Efforts

 

Beginning in January of this year the Township initiated an emphasis on identifying the  businesses located in the township.  The township intends to meet with all companies large and small as part of a Business Expansion And Retention (B.E.A.R). program. The program will attempt to identify their status and needs. It is hoped this program will aid in the retention and growing of the local businesses. In turn, providing local employment, and building a healthy local economy.

 

Recognizing the need to provide a balanced community through building a viable business climate while protecting the residential integrity of the community, the Board of Supervisors are promoting economic development within the township and Pennridge area. This effort commenced in 1998 when Township Manager, John V. Cornell, began professional training at the Penn State Economic Development Course and continued with the National Economic Development Institute through the University of Oklahoma.  In April of this year, Mr. Cornell will complete the third and final level of training and graduate from the Institute. A requirement for graduation is a thesis or project. With the timely opening of the new Bucks County Community College Upper County Campus,  the economic impact on the local college  was chosen.

 

All residents are encouraged to patronize the local businesses. Beginning in April of this year a new updated community map will be mailed to each household.  Be sure to thank the local sponsors and support their business.
